BMRN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2016 in Review

391 of the 3,748 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in BioMarin Pharmaceuticals (BMRN) for Q2 2016, worth a combined $12.4B — down 6.8% from $13.3B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 45 funds opened new BMRN positions and 38 closed out — a net gain of 7 holders — while 163 added to existing stakes and 120 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Alyeska Investment Group, adding an estimated $78.5M. The largest seller was Royal London Asset Management, cutting an estimated $262M.
